A Rogue for a Lady (The Duke's Daughters Book 1) by Rose Pearson

This story is well handled. Amelia and Arthur are good together. This story reminds us why secrets between lovers are dangerous. Amelia is brainless and or "feather-headed" in this book, because she believes a man who sneaks around Arthur's house instead of asking the man she loves. He introduces himself in a park instead of waiting for a proper introduction while Arthur has been nothing but a gentleman to Amelia. The only sister of the quartet that seems to have a brain in her head is the second sister, Harmonia. I am looking forward to her story.
